Federal Charges Filed in Topeka Robbery Case

Prosecutors are filing federal charges against two Topeka men accused of armed robbery. Police say Derick Renee Crawford and Travis Jeremy Coffman held up a Topeka Red Robin restaurant in August. U.S. Attorney Barry Grissom says federal officials are working with the Topeka Police Department to crack down on violent crime. Shawnee County District Attorney Chad Taylor says pursuit of the longer possible prison terms connected with federal charges are designed to issue a warning to other criminals.

The two men could face several decades in prison if convicted on all charges.
